Handover: Brigid to Olen, Fernwheel build migration

Olen — the core libraries now build hermetically; remaining work is the codegen step, which still shells out to a system toolchain and breaks reproducibility. I've pinned everything else in the lockfile. When reviewing my open change, focus on the sandbox declarations rather than the target graph. Full migration status, open issues, and verification steps are tracked on the internal page below.

runbook for hafop-tafof: https://jira.zemvarsys.internal/browse/display/display/browse

# Sweepline Environment Variables

Sweepline is our data-retention sweeper for the Marrowfield cluster. It wakes hourly, finds records past their TTL, and tombstones them. Key vars: `SWEEP_INTERVAL_MIN` (default 60), `SWEEP_BATCH_SIZE` (keep under 5000 or the janitor queue backs up), and `SWEEP_DRY_RUN` (set true in any new environment, seriously). One more thing: the sweeper authenticates to the retention ledger with a secret that must be defined on the line immediately after these settings.

sealed setting: ARCHIVE_KEY3=8d0

Hey Marisol — handing over Nightloom, our backfill scheduler, while I'm out. The review branch adds retry windows for failed runs; nothing fancy, just check the cron parsing. One gotcha: the scheduler reads its run ledger from the ops database, not the main cluster. For local testing, point your environment at the ledger using this connection string.

primary connection of tawif-yajeg = postgresql://rusiel_svc:G879q9cx6GsSvj@db-dd9f.norvagrid.internal:5432/casath

## Service Accounts: Order-Cutoff Rule

The Crumbline bakery platform enforces a hard order cutoff at 14:00 local time, evaluated by the cutoff-rules service. Future maintainers: the cutoff is checked server-side by a dedicated service account, not in the storefront, so client clock skew is irrelevant. The account has read-only access to store schedules and write access only to rejection logs. It authenticates against the Crumbline rules engine using the key below.

gateway credential: vxb23-9oKnkba9XXytzGuXGSkTice